Northeastern Junior College (NJC)
- 100 College Avenue
- Sterling, CO 80751
- OPEID College Code: 00136100
-

- General Phone: (970) 521-6600
- President: Lance Bolton, Ph.d.
- Website: www.njc.edu

- Type: Public, 2-Year
- Calendar System: Semester
- Highest Degree: Associate's Degree
- Local Area: Rural Fringe
- Student Enrollment: 2,751
- College Alias: NJC, Northeastern

- Mission Statement
- Northeastern Junior College is a comprehensive two-year institution that is committed to providing excellence in learning, training, and service. We strive to produce skilled and knowledgeable students who transfer successfully and enter the workforce productively. We strive to enrich the quality of lives through affordable and accessible learning opportunities.

- Financial Aid Links and Information
- Percent of Students Receiving Financial Aid: 74%
Financial Aid Breakdown 2006-07
| Loan | Federal Grant | State/Local Grant | Institutional Grant |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| (%) of Students Receiving | 44% | 38% | 26% | 35% |
| Avg Amount Receiving | $3,100 | $2,813 | $1,732 | $1,988 |
Federal Loan Default Rates
| 2006 | 2005 | 2004 |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Default Rate (%) | 8.8% | 6.2% | 7.0% |
| Number in Default | 33 | 23 | 24 |
| Number in Repayment | 373 | 370 | 342 |
Undergraduate Student Expenses
| 2007-08 | 2006-07 | 2005-06 |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tuition, Fees and Other Expenses | |||
| In-State Tuition and Fees | $2,400 | $2,382 | $2,315 |
| Out of State Tuition and Fees | $7,406 | $7,219 | $7,195 |
| Books and Supplies | $1,698 | $1,698 | $1,306 |
| Housing Expenses | |||
| On Campus | |||
| Room and Board | $5,321 | $5,162 | $5,121 |
| Other Expenses | $4,212 | $3,582 | $3,528 |
| Off Campus | |||
| Room and Board | $8,091 | $7,641 | $7,236 |
| Other Expenses | $4,212 | $3,582 | $3,528 |
| Off Campus with Family | |||
| Other Expenses | $4,068 | $3,582 | $3,528 |
| Total Expenses | |||
| On Campus | |||
| In-State | $13,631 | $12,824 | $12,270 |
| Out of State | $18,637 | $17,661 | $17,150 |
| Off Campus | |||
| In-State | $16,401 | $15,303 | $14,385 |
| Out of State | $21,407 | $20,140 | $19,265 |
| Off Campus with Family | |||
| In-State | $8,166 | $7,527 | $7,149 |
| Out of State | $13,172 | $12,364 | $12,029 |

- Retention Rates
- Full-Time Entering Students Retained: 61%
- Part-Time Entering Students Retained: 30%
Graduation Rates
| (%) of Entering Class | |
|---|---|
| Overall | |
| All Students | 38% |
| By Gender | |
| Male | 28% |
| Female | 48% |
| By Race | |
| Non-Resident Alien | 100% |
| American Indian | 20% |
| Black | 11% |
| Asian | - |
| Hispanic | 11% |
| White | 44% |
